💪 It's Leadership Week Day 4 and our Instructional Leadership Team is still going strong! 💪 We continued our work around "Project-Based Learning" today as we really honed our focus on "ALEs" (Authentic Learning Experiences) for our students. What is authentic learning? Basically, anything that allows our students connect their learning to real-world issues, problems, or applications. 💭 💭 Think about the difference between turning in a worksheet on measurement for your teacher to grade vs. working with your classmates to design a model home that meets certain dimension specifications for someone in your local community. How much more powerful is that second experience for our kids!! P.S. - You wanna talk about something else powerful?? 🧑🏻‍🏫 👩🏼‍🏫 🧑🏽‍🏫 Bring in the Instructional Crew! 🧑🏼‍🏫 👩🏿‍🏫 👩🏻‍🏫 For Leadership Week Day 3, our Instructional Coaches joined our building admin teams to dig into teaching and learning systems for this school year. We dug into "Project-Based Learning" - learning that is designed to give students the opportunity to develop knowledge and skills through engaging projects set around challenges and problems they may face in the real world.
